To prevent oscillation, ensure that the input signals are properly filtered and decoupled, and that the output is properly loaded. Additionally, consider adding hysteresis to the comparator by connecting a resistor and capacitor between the output and the inverting input.
No, the LM339ADRE4 is a comparator, not an amplifier. It is designed to compare two input voltages and output a digital signal indicating which input is higher. It is not suitable for amplifying small signals.
The pull-up resistor value depends on the load current required by the output circuit. A general rule of thumb is to choose a value between 1kΩ and 10kΩ. A higher value reduces power consumption but increases the rise time of the output signal.
Yes, the LM339ADRE4 can be used with a single supply voltage. However, the input common-mode voltage range is limited to VCC - 2V, so ensure that the input signals are within this range.
